Goodwill North Central Texas to Host Grantsmanship Training Course for Nonprofit and Government Grantseekers

FORT WORTH, TEXAS (May 9, 2018) —Goodwill North Central Texas and the Dallas Public Library will co-host a Grantsmanship Training Program in Fort Worth, the week of June 4-8.

About Goodwill North Central Texas

Goodwill is more than a thrift store. The largest employer of people with disabilities in the world, Goodwill believes that work has the power to transform lives by building self-confidence, independence, creativity, trust and friendships. Everyone deserves this chance.

Goodwill North Central Texas’s 23 retail locations provide revenue through the sale of donated goods to support Goodwill’s mission – job training and career services for people with disabilities, such as physical or mental disabilities and other barriers to employment including lack of education or work experience and homelessness.
